Transaction d589ef888a7308e34020ca851d228a57310b342671ea61c58c5d198f69624687
1 Input
1 Output
-
d589ef888a7308e34020ca851d228a57310b342671ea61c58c5d198f69624687:0
- value
- 40322
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 441b0f0828a7e90ea1a2496d58a854088619077e1e3650291729a5e38bb1fb06
- address
- bc1pgsds7zpg5l5sagdzf9k432z5pzrpjpm7rcm9q2gh9xj78za3lvrq20evyu